He Never Thought DSA Could Be Fun. Then He Found the Right Teacher.

    He Never Thought DSA Could Be Fun. Then He Found the Right Teacher.

    Think DSA is dry and boring? Abhinav Sharma didn't. Learn how the right teaching style transformed a "difficult" subject into an engaging experience that led to a career at ADP.

    default profile

    Rohan Saxena

    February 18, 2026

    2 min read

    Before the Switch#

    Abhinav Sharma was working as an ML Intern at JKDaily when he enrolled in Coding Shuttle's DSA Course. He was not running away from machine learning. He was building toward something broader, a technical foundation strong enough to compete for roles at companies like ADP, one of the world's largest HR and payroll technology platforms.

    What he did not expect was that learning DSA would actually be enjoyable.


    The Point Where Things Had to Change#

    Developers working in AI-adjacent roles often underestimate how much DSA matters. The logical rigor that comes from truly understanding algorithms does not just help in interviews. It shapes how you think about problems, how you break down complex systems, and how you approach the kind of engineering challenges that generative AI applications are built on.

    Abhinav needed that foundation and he needed it in a form that would actually stick, not just memorized patterns but real understanding. He found both in Coding Shuttle.


    Where Coding Shuttle Came In#

    The thing that made the difference for Abhinav was Anuj Bhaiya's teaching style. DSA has a reputation for being dry, mechanical, and painful to get through. That reputation exists because most people who teach it treat it that way. Anuj does not. The course made the material engaging in a way that kept Abhinav showing up and doing the work, which is ultimately the only thing that produces results.


    In Abhinav's Own Words#

    "Had a blast doing this course, never thought DSA could be so engaging. All thanks to Anuj Bhaiya and his teaching style."


    Where He Stands Today#

    Abhinav Sharma is now a GPT Intern at ADP in Hyderabad, working at the intersection of generative AI and enterprise technology. His review says something important for every developer who has been putting off DSA because it feels too hard or too boring: the right teacher changes everything. Abhinav found that teacher and it changed his career.

    Want to Master Spring Boot and Land Your Dream Job?

    Struggling with coding interviews? Learn Data Structures & Algorithms (DSA) with our expert-led course. Build strong problem-solving skills, write optimized code, and crack top tech interviews with ease

    Learn more
    Job Switch
    From service based to product based switch
    success story
    Big 4 interview experience
    coding shuttle review
    coding shuttle student review
    career switch
    Was it helpful?

    Subscribe to our newsletter

    Read articles from Coding Shuttle directly inside your inbox. Subscribe to the newsletter, and don't miss out.

    More articles